February Lust List

February is a always a weird time clothing-wise. Even though it’s clearly winter, my mind is always skipping ahead toward warmer months. Transition pieces with a focus on warmth are what I’m lusting after for February.

faux leather jacket, floral scarf, striped dress, bright fliatsA faux leather jacket is year-round appropriate, but especially great during the spring and fall. It just so happens to look incredibly fresh this time of year with my #2 pick: a floral scarf.

Being a girly girl, I’m loving all of the floral prints for spring, but I’m not quite ready to fully commit. Adding a lightweight floral scarf is the perfect transition piece that makes me feel sunny even the weatherman says it’s below freezing.

Another piece that works year-round is a classic t-shirt dress. This one in a nautical stripe, which I’m obviously obsessed with, is perfect layered under tights, boots and a jacket for now. Come spring, I’ll be rocking it sans layers. Bonus: this baby doubles as a bathing suit cover up during the summer. Dress, you’ve already paid for yourself.

My last pick probably needs little explanation: fun bright flats are the perfect way to infuse a little spring into my winter wardrobe without overspending. You better believe come February 10 that I’ll be stalking Target’s website to snap these up!
